Crosshair Overlay
This mod allows you to overlay your own custom crosshair (or any image you want) over the game.
Usage
All customisation options are available through the mod's config file~ these include:
- Tinting the image, and modifying the opacity
- Changing the size of the image
- Changing the offset of the image from the center of the screen
- Whether to hide the default crosshair
- Whether to overlay or underlay the image relative to UI
- Whether the crosshair should be hidden in the main menu
You can change the active crosshair. To do so, place a png or jpeg image in the mod's install directory, and
change the config option File name
to the name of the image (with extension).
Manual Installation Instructions
(you should probably just use a mod manager like r2modman or gale though)
!!! You need Bepinex 5 for mono !!! (if you have no idea what the versions mean try BepInEx_win_x64_5.4.23.2 and it might work. maybe)
Once bepinex is installed, extract the contents of the zip into the BepInEx/plugins folder in the game's root directory.
